[The influence of a therapy with vasodilating agents on the sleep EEG of patients with cerebral circulatory disturbances. Results of a double blind study (author's transl)].

E Schneider, B Ziegler, P Jacobi, H Maxion.   

Abstract

In 30 patients (24 men, 6 women) aged from 30-74 years and suffering from ischemic lesions in the cerebral hemispheres all-night EEG recordings before and after a 3 weeks' treatment with vasodilating drugs were carried out. At the same time the development of the clinico-neurological and psychoorganic symptomatology, also using test psychological methods, were studied. The drugs--10 patients received 50 mg raubasin, 6 patients 500 mg bencyclan and the others a salt solution--were administered i.v. Under the treatment no change in the primary sleep EEG findings could be observed, whereas there was an improvement of the clinico-neurological and psychoorganic symptomatology in the drug as well as in the placebo group. The lack of improvement in mood and state of well-being is discussed in its relationship to the sleep behaviour.
